Understanding the Nature of a Mobile Home Park: As a mobile home park, Moorgate likely operates on a model where residents own their individual mobile homes but lease the land (the lot) on which they are situated from the park management. This arrangement typically includes the provision of essential infrastructure and services by the park to ensure comfortable long-term living.
Potential Location and Surrounding Environment: Moorgate's address on Hosner Mountain Road in Hopewell Junction, New York, offers some clues about its potential setting. Hopewell Junction is a hamlet within the town of East Fishkill in Dutchess County, known for its blend of suburban and rural characteristics. Hosner Mountain Road suggests that Moorgate might be located in a slightly more elevated or geographically distinct area, potentially offering scenic views or a more secluded feel compared to the main thoroughfares of Hopewell Junction. The surrounding environment likely includes a mix of residential properties, local businesses, and natural landscapes typical of the Hudson Valley region.
Dutchess County is known for its picturesque scenery, historical sites, and access to the Hudson River.
